Job Description

Job Overview Want to be part of the office team for the company making the best hardwood flooring in the USA? Come join us at Muscanell Millworks as a Customer Service Representative where you will work in a collaborative, supportive, and relaxed office environment! This is an office position where you will be responsible for all customer service for our two largest customers. Training will primarily be provided by our current customer service/sales representative, but you will have the support of the rest of the office.
Hours:
Monday-Friday with half days on Fridays (8 a.m. - noon) In addition to answering questions via phone and email from our two biggest customers, this position will be responsible for assisting retail and other walk-in customers, including lifting 40lb. bags of Woodchucks fire logs. Lastly, this position will need to occasionally aid in answering and directing phone calls in the absence of our administrative assistant. Duties Communicate with customers by email and phone regarding quotes, orders, shipments, and product questions Help local retail customers Process quotes and orders Provide pricing and lead times Invoice or double check invoicing of customer purchases Collect payments for purchases Schedule trucks for product shipment Fulfill customer requests (brochures, samples, etc.) and follow-up to ensure requests are being met in a timely manner Travel as needed to support customers Maintain proper documentation of customer issues, quotes, orders, shipments, and other communications Manage customer accounts Reach out to customers regularly to resolve issues before they become a problem Coordinate tours and visits for customers Maintain the order schedule Create and properly distribute BOLs for customer shipments Other responsibilities as assigned Qualifications Proven experience in administrative roles with clerical responsibilities Strong computer skills including pro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el), Google Workspace (Docs, Sheets), and data entry systems Excellent organizational skills with keen attention to detail and accuracy in proofreading and typing Previous customer service experience demonstrating effective communication and problem-solving abilities Familiarity with multi-line phone systems, front desk operations, and office procedures such as filing and calendar management Ability to manage time efficiently while handling mult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ment Benefits Health, dental, & vision insurance Monthly crew lunch Annual picnic and Christmas party Growth opportunities Half-day Fridays Paid holidays Employer-matching retirement savings plan Paid time off (PTO) Annual incentive bonus (on financially successful years) Discounts on Muscanell products
